ABSTRACT

The proximity of the proposed Bosphorus tunnel site to the fault system in the Sea of Marmara (see Figure 1) as well as the critical site soil conditions makes the safe seismic design of the tunnel one of the most critical elements of the project. Current seismic design methodology for mass transit rail facilities has in general adopted a performance-based two-level design earthquake approach – a low level, high probability Functional Evaluation Earthquake (FEE) and a high level, low probability Safety Evaluation Earthquake (SEE). However, because of the unique seismological settings in the project region, the generally adopted two-level design earthquake approach is modified for this project.
